Who Are We?

Founded in 1963, the Aurora Historical Society strives to be a vibrant community-focused champion, preserving and promoting Aurora’s history and the Hillary House museum, Aurora’s National Historic Site. We do this through Education, Preservation, and Restoration.

Education:  The AHS offers programs for young and old, ranging from our popular lecture series with knowledgeable guest speakers to hands-on crafts for children.  We offer tours and changing exhibits at Hillary House; a growing online presence; and programs tailored to the interests of school groups and community organizations.  We are storytellers, keeping the stories of our community and its people alive.

Preservation:  In its formative years, the AHS played a leading role in preserving Aurora’s historic Church Street School (now home to the Aurora Cultural Centre, Museum and Archives), the Aurora Railway Station, and Aurora’s historic neighbourhoods.  In 1981, the AHS acquired ownership of Hillary House in order to preserve this very special and architecturally significant Aurora landmark for present and future generations to enjoy.  We strive to preserve Hillary House and its important collections of medical and household artifacts, books and documents according to the highest standards.

Restoration:  As owners of Hillary House, the AHS is responsible for restoring this landmark to reflect its many roles in the life of our community as doctor’s office, family home, and social centre with spacious lawns, gardens, and even a tennis court.  We work closely with the Ontario Heritage Trust and Parks Canada, but ultimately the responsibility is ours. Restoration is costly and ongoing as we strive to maintain the highest possible standards.
